Mr. Charles Ronnie "Ron" Langley

July 8, 1947 - May 16, 2012

Graveside services with honors by the Calhoun County Sheriff's Department Honor Guard for Ronnie "Ron" Langley, 64, of Jacksonville will be Friday at 1:00 p.m. at Highway Church of God Cemetery in Fyffe with the Rev. Don Brown, Chief Deputy Matthew Wade and Deputy Don Hull officiating. The family will receive friends at Thompson Funeral Home in Piedmont Thursday from 6-8 p.m. Mr. Langley passed away Wednesday, May 16, 2012 at his home. Survivors include his wife of 41 years, Gail Langley; brother, Ed Langley of Piedmont; two god sons, Lee Langley and Bran Lawler both of Piedmont; and numerous nieces and nephews. Pallbearers will be Jimmy Williams, Bobby Hammonds, Lee Langley, Bran Lawler, Van White, Brad Edmondson and John Davis. Honorary pallbearers will be the Calhoun County Sheriff's Department. Mr. Langley was a native and lifelong resident of Calhoun County. He retired from the Anniston Army Depot and worked as a deputy sheriff for the Calhoun County Sheriff's Department. He was a Vietnam veteran, served as a crewman on a rescue helicopter in the U.S.Navy, was a graduate of Jacksonville State University, was an avid hunter and fisherman, and loved Alabama football and his family.
